Day 7 of #RedeemTheSelfie
Challenge: Physical Friday
Post a picture of yourself doing something physical: working out, walking, running, lifting, energetically eating things, running away, or a part of you that you’re proud of.
Reluctant to post this... seems too much like, “Look at me! Come see how good I think I look...” #ronburgundy I’m usually proud of my legs - I’ve always had really strong legs, but the job I currently have has really gotten my shoulders and arms... can’t say I’m opposed to it.
I’ve found myself getting concerned with the number of likes, favorites, or notes that this is producing... 1. It’s nothing I can influence... 2. Not the point Scott... It’s so much easier to think and focus on the #2 in the original post, how you capture yourself, than it is to think of how you see yourself, or how/why you share your image with others.
I’m not sharing this image to show y'all how beefcake-y I am... it’s one of those selfies (ugh, that word again) that comes up A LOT and I wanted to do it. It’s probably my least favorite one to date. It really feels like showing off or one-upping... I can see if you’ve just done something physical you’re really proud of and you want to share the moment, but shots like these just seem to shout something I don’t really like...
I’ve never been really comfortable with my body (not comparing to women AT ALL)... I was quite the chubster when I was younger. I’ve always thought my love handles were too big, my chest not big enough, etc. There are messages about how men should look, and I’m trying to just live in my skin.

#RedeemTheSelfie
Right off: I don’t like “selfies.”
I don’t like the word, “selfie.” I tend to judge people who relentlessly post selfies day in and day out. I largely thing that they are self-absorbed narcissists who are their own self-promoters in all-things-life over social media...
Have I mentioned I don’t like selfies?
However, I’d really like to try and take a look at it from a different angle if I can, and seeing as this selfie thing isn’t going away, neither is the selfie-stick (God help us all), I would like to try to see it from another point of view...
the point of view of the selfie-ist... (I think I made a new word there).
Everyday for the month of August... yes, everyday... I will be taking a selfie and posting it here, and on Instagram (@s_t_robertson). I’m really not looking forward to the new daily routine, but I really hope to learn something here...
There are three things going on with the selfie:
1. How you see yourself.
2. How you capture yourself.
3. How to display yourself to others.
The second one is a matter of experience and technique... I’m confident I’ll figure that one out.
The third I’ll really be running the gamut: taking some of the classic selfie pics: the eating selfie, the workout selfie, the just woke up selfie, the just going to bed selfie, the working selfie, the mirrors-mirrors-everywhere selfie, different angles, the criticize-myself-but-fish-for-compliments selfie, etc... but I’ll be trying to not just capture myself looking good (”Hey everybody, come see how good I look!”) but in moments and with a look I don’t want to capture, let alone share with all of you...
My hope, is that over the next month I’ll discover more about #1. How do I see myself? Do I not take selfies because I don’t like what I see? Will I see myself differently at the end? Will I develop an enhanced ego? Will I see how others and God see me better? Will I think of myself as more important? Will I carry myself differently?
I’m not trying to revolutionize the selfie... I’m trying to step into it and see what it means for me...
